Connection manager

As soon as the first connection is established the connection manager is started and it is shut down when all connections have been closed. This manager consists in a background thread handling the communication protocol required by the Mosel Distributed Framework. The functions of this section can be used to control this manager: start and stop independently of active connections as well as handling of messages.

Set the message callback.
Change the verbosity level of the library.
Shut down the connection manager.
Start the connection manager.
